I rather regret buying the Steinberg IXO 22! When I searched the net for reviews, there were excellent reviews most of the times, but the reality is I have two main problems with it. First, it can't support my DT 990 Pro (250 OHM) but it supports fine the Sennheiser HD 280 Pro (64 OHM). The second problem is my Yamaha monitors (HS7) have more noise with it than other audio interface. Also, the Yamaha MODX main outputs when plugged to the monitors are very noisy even if I put the synth 2 metres away! I'm using a Behringher UMC404HD that I bought as a temporary solution while deciding what to buy. Works really well. I even bought it again after loosing my first one. The outputs sounds clean on my studio monitors even at high levels. Has balanced outputs, besides jack and rca. You can route outputs 3-4 to the headphone out. Don't know if it pairs well with high impedance headphones. My AKG K702 have 62 ohm impedance. Inputs are not the greatest but useable. Low latency and class compliant. Never had a problem in Bitwig using the proprietary Asio drivers. It even has midi in/out ports.
